WebHuntington’s disease symptoms. Early symptoms — irritability, moodiness, loss of balance, and difficulty making decisions — typically show up during a person’s mid-30s to 40s. How quickly Huntington’s disease progresses, as well as the types and severity of symptoms, varies from person to person. WebToday in HD history On April 13th, 1872, George Huntington published a paper called “On Chorea,” describing the disease that would come to be known by his name.
